[ Guests cannot view attachments ] This is my first cyclekart build, started August 2022. Any questions please ask.

Also i found this site www.slotracer.online/artomotive/index.html which has scale drawings for custom slotcars which i downloaded and stuck to some graph paper, giving me 1 square to 1 inch and an almost perfect scaling of the car.
